gpt4 book ai didi

mysql - 从 mysql 数据库转储中排除 View

转载 作者:可可西里 更新时间:2023-11-01 08:17:26 24 4
gpt4 key购买 nike

有没有办法从 mysql 转储导出中排除 View

我尝试了 --ignore-table 命令。但是这个命令推荐了我想排除的表的参数。

我的数据库中有 30 个 View 。

有什么简单的方法可以只导出表格(不导出 View )吗?

谢谢

最佳答案

基于答案here ,您应该能够将表对象通过管道传输到 mysqldump,例如:

mysql -u username INFORMATION_SCHEMA
--skip-column-names --batch
-e "select table_name from tables where table_type = 'BASE TABLE'
and table_schema = 'database'"
| xargs mysqldump -u username database
> tables.sql

关于mysql - 从 mysql 数据库转储中排除 View 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21431825/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com